That side exhaust is sick!!!Got some testing in on Saturday, as it was 45-47 degrees. No sun though, so still a bit dodgey. Packed the truck up and headed to my test spot, one last test with the ceramic bearings in.
View attachment 178210
Used the black body out of thinking I don't want to demolish one of my good green ones. I knew that this wasn't the best idea, but we are about to get doused with Winter here real soon apparently, so figured one last try to see what it can do and get some video. Conditions last time were about the same, and I had some traction issues, so my hopes weren't real high.
Figured I'd take a pic in case I wrecked it.
View attachment 178211
The car is a pretty far cry from the original, 2019 version! (bottom car was 6.7 lbs, with a small block and plastic gears vs 5.9 for the big block, steel geared car on top that has twice the HP!)
View attachment 178212
No wrecks, this was after two passes, car intact!
View attachment 178213
So, two hits, and they were both full passes, though I did have to get out of it at about 110-120 feet and coast to the 132 mark, but still going by the video time, these were right at about 2.0 seconds. The car started pulling right, which was probably due to losing traction when the car hits the peak power band. Doesn't help that it's riding the bar pretty much the whole run too (I do have the bar set really low, so the front wheels aren't too far up, but still had no steering). Thinking I should have used the green body because the wing on that body has way more downforce. Might have at least stayed planted.
Mo powa!I put the engine back together over the weekend and fired it up in my garage. Wanted to test out the big nitrous bottle. (pic from another post here)
View attachment 184542
It's double the size of the little one, which definitely worked but after seeing how much that .12 jumped in power with the little one, I figured the .30 needed a larger shot. I did a few tests to see how the engine reacted with it just sitting there idling. With the little bottle, the RPMS would just jump up. Testing with the big one, it's hard to explain, but the RPMS do surge, but it's a different sound altogether, kind of what I hear with the .12 and the small bottle. So, I think I was on to something.
View attachment 184547
I put the body on and charged the nitrous up to 70 PSI for a little test in front of the house. It was only 45 deg and the wind was picking up and temps dropping, so I didn't figure driving out to my usual spot would be a good idea since it's usually much windier there. Did a quick launch test, hitting nitrous at 10 ft. Good freaking lord Maybe one day I put these things on a dyno to find out just how much more power it's throwing down, but I can say, it's definitely a LOT.
I don't have video, but we have warm temps on the way, I should have something this week.
